What is 269278645298734569827634598264956384775628456298743 divided by 9865298746528945692873659827465245

Jun 10, 2019

$$\frac{269278645298734569827634598264956384775628456298743}{9865298746528945692873659827465245}$$ = 27295538859730818.3446586092722013

Jun 10, 2019
It is around 27,295,538,859,730,818.34465860927220128658, or around twenty-seven quadrillion two hundred ninety-five trillion five hundred thirty-eight billion eight hundred fifty-nine million seven hundred thirty thousand eight hundred eighteen and thirty-four quintillion four hundred sixty-five quadrillion eight hundred sixty trillion nine hundred twenty-seven billion two hundred twenty million one hundred twenty-eight thousand six hundred fifty-eight hundred quintillionths.

Jun 10, 2019
